How often should you clean your 1000-liter water tank?
The frequency of cleaning your 1000-liter water tank may depend on various factors such as the quality of the incoming water, environmental conditions, and usage. However, it is generally recommended to clean your cisterna at least once every six months. If you notice any signs of contamination or the water quality appears compromised, it is advisable to clean the tank immediately.
What are the efficient techniques to clean your 1000-liter water tank?
Follow these step-by-step techniques to ensure an efficient and thorough cleaning process:
- Prepare the necessary tools: Gather the required equipment such as gloves, face mask, scrub brushes, detergents, and a hose.
- Isolate the tank: Shut off the water supply to the tank and drain any remaining water from the tank.
- Remove debris: Use a scoop or your hand to remove any visible debris, leaves, or insects from the tank.
- Scrub the interior walls: Use a scrub brush and a mixture of water and mild detergent to thoroughly scrub the interior walls of the tank. Pay special attention to corners, seams, and any areas that may accumulate sediment.
- Rinse: Rinse the tank thoroughly with clean water to remove any soap residue or remaining debris.
- Disinfection: Use a disinfectant recommended for water tanks to sanitize the cleaned tank. Follow the instructions provided by the manufacturer.
- Allow drying time: Leave the tank open to air dry completely before refilling it with fresh water.
What are some additional tips and tricks?
Consider these additional tips and tricks to ensure an effective cleaning process:
- Always wear protective gear such as gloves and a face mask to avoid contact with harmful bacteria or chemicals during the cleaning process.
- Check the condition of the tank regularly for any cracks or leaks and repair them promptly.
- Keep the area around the tank clean and free from vegetation or debris to prevent contamination.
- Consider installing a filtration system or using chlorine tablets to maintain water quality between cleanings.
